#f7cab8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f7cab8 is composed of 96.9% red, 79.2%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.2% magenta, 25.5%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 84.5%. #f7cab8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ef9571.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#f7cab8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110602 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f7cab8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d9d7d6 is the less saturated color, while #fdc7b2 is the most saturated one.
